What did traditional Egyptian artwork look like during the time of the great pharaohs?

From today's perspective the works of art made in ancient Egypt are quite different from what we are used to in art. The pictures could look very formal, and also blocky. Some could argue they looked abstract in a way as well. They were also static. When we compare them to later Rennaisance art found in Europe, the style is strikingly different. Hieroglyphs (the way ancient Egyptians wrote) also accompanied pictures and images of all kinds very often and were sometimes precisely carved as an artwork of their own.

A person who agreed to work in exchange for passage to the colonies? Who is that person ?

Indentured servants is the correct answer.
These are usually people who wanted to go to the new world, but are too poor to finance themselves for the trip, and so they agree with a person on the amount of time they would work for their 'master' in exchange for a "free passage"
